Geotechnical engineers analyse all the area test records to make sure that construction is taking place as per the task specification. Throughout construction, a confirmatory test for soil compaction is done on-site to ensure that no future settlement occurs


After the concrete is poured -7 days and 28 days- examinations are performed on concrete examples collected from the website to ensure that the concrete poured fulfills the style criterion. Asphalt core is taken after the Asphalt is laid and compressed to verify that it satisfies the design criterion. All lab examination records are evaluated by the Geotechnical Engineer to ensure that it fulfills the project requirements.

These procedures enable experts to analyze a host of dirt technicians including weight, porosity, void-to-solid fragment proportion, leaks in the structure, compressibility, maximum shear strength, birthing capability and contortions. If the structure requires a deep foundation, designers will certainly use a cone infiltration test to approximate the quantity of skin and end Web Site bearing resistance in the subsurface.




 


When analyzing a slope's balance of shear anxiety and shear toughness, or its capacity to stand up to and go through movement, rotational slides and translational slides are frequently taken into consideration. Rotational slides fail along a rounded surface area, with translational slides taking place on a planar surface. An expert's objective is to identify the problems at which a slope failure could take place.


Often, findings recommend that a website's soil must be treated to enhance its shear strength, tightness and leaks in the structure prior to style and building. When it comes time to set out structure strategies, professionals are significantly concentrated on sustainability, more especially how to minimize a foundation's carbon impact. One method has actually been to change 20 percent of a foundation's concrete with fly ash, a waste product from coal fire nuclear power plant.
